Chris is a licensed architect with 15 years of experience who has built his career at QA+M Architecture specializing in multi-family, public housing, and municipal projects. He takes pride in designing projects that improve residents’ quality of life, and serve and support the surrounding populace. His recent work includes ADA and capital upgrades at the Dublin Village complex in Colchester, CT, providing affordable housing for the disabled and elderly community, and the Connecticut Institute for Communities’ new Danbury Health Center, a four-story medical office building where community members can receive affordable, comprehensive healthcare.

QA+M Architecture is a full-service architectural firm that provides programming, planning and interior design for clients in Commercial, community, education, healthcare, historical, housing, and recreational/athletic markets. Staffed by 33 dedicated professionals, including 18 licensed architects, the firm has grown into one of the 10 largest architectural firms in Connecticut.
